S06.373S
ICD-10-CMContusion, laceration, and hemorrhage of cerebellum with loss of consciousness of 1 hour to 5 hours 59 minutes, sequela
This code signifies a past injury to the cerebellum involving bruising, tearing, and bleeding, which resulted in a prolonged period of unconsciousness lasting between one and nearly six hours. It indicates that the patient is now experiencing residual effects or complications stemming from this specific brain trauma.
Apply this code when documenting the long-term consequences or sequelae of a cerebellar injury that initially presented with a loss of consciousness within the specified timeframe. Documentation should clearly state the original injury, the duration of unconsciousness, and the current sequela being treated or evaluated.
